Gazebo Sealing in Renton, WA
Gazebo sealing services involve applying protective coatings to the surfaces of outdoor structures like gazebos, pergolas, and similar wooden or composite features. This process helps prevent water infiltration, wood rot, and damage caused by exposure to rain, snow, and humidity. Property owners often request this service to preserve the appearance and structural integrity of their outdoor living spaces, especially in regions with variable weather conditions. Projects can range from sealing newly built gazebos to maintaining older structures that require re-sealing to extend their lifespan.
Before requesting gazebo sealing services, homeowners typically want to understand the types of sealants used, the recommended frequency of application, and how the process may impact their outdoor space. It’s also common to inquire about preparation steps, such as cleaning or sanding, and whether the sealing will affect the gazebo’s appearance or color. Clear communication about these aspects ensures the project meets expectations and helps maintain the outdoor structure’s durability and visual appeal over time.

Gazebo Sealing Questions
What is gazebo sealing? Gazebo sealing involves applying protective materials to prevent water infiltration and weather damage, helping to extend the lifespan of the structure.
Why should homeowners consider gazebo sealing? Sealing helps protect the gazebo from moisture, rot, and decay, maintaining its appearance and structural integrity over time.
What types of materials are used for sealing gazebos? Common sealing materials include waterproof sealants, weatherproof paints, and specialized caulks designed for outdoor wood and metal surfaces.
When is the best time to have a gazebo sealed? Sealing is typically recommended during dry, mild weather conditions to ensure proper adhesion and effectiveness of the sealant.
